在Excel导出过程中,报错和文件格式错误是常见的问题,以下是对这些问题的详细分析及解决方法:
常见原因
1、文件损坏:文件在生成或传输过程中可能会损坏,导致无法正常打开。
2、文件格式不支持:某些版本的Excel可能不支持最新的文件格式,如.xlsx
。
3、文件名包含特殊字符:文件名中包含特殊字符或空格可能导致下载失败。
4、数据量过大:当导出的数据量超过Excel的最大支持范围时,可能会出现报错。
5、文件被占用:如果尝试导出Excel文件时,该文件正在被其他程序占用,导出操作可能会失败。
6、文件路径错误:如果指定的导出路径包含非法字符或无效路径,导出操作也会失败。
7、权限问题:如果没有足够权限将文件导出到指定路径,导出操作将无法完成。
8、Excel应用程序问题:如果Excel应用程序出现故障或损坏,导出操作可能受到影响。
9、文件格式不受支持:如果尝试将文件导出为不受支持的格式,导出操作会失败。
10、缺少字体:Excel文件中使用了特定字体,但电脑上未安装该字体,显示会出错。
11、隐藏的单元格或行:Excel中的某些单元格或行被隐藏,会导致数据显示不完整。
12、宏或脚本问题:Excel文件中包含的宏或脚本未正确运行,可能导致格式显示不正确。
13、硬件问题:硬盘或内存的问题也可能导致文件打开时出现问题。
解决方法
1、重新生成文件:如果怀疑文件损坏,可以尝试重新生成Excel文件。
2、更新Excel版本:如果文件格式不支持,可以考虑更新Excel到最新版本。
3、修改文件名:将文件名中的特殊字符和空格删除或替换,确保文件名符合规范。
4、分批导出数据:如果数据量过大,可以尝试分批次导出,以避免超出Excel的限制。
5、关闭占用程序:确保关闭其他正在使用该文件的程序,然后再尝试导出。
6、检查文件路径:确保导出路径正确,并且不包含特殊字符或无效字符。
7、检查权限设置:确保具有足够的权限来写入指定的导出路径。
8、修复Excel应用程序:尝试重新启动Excel或重新安装Excel应用程序。
9、选择正确的文件格式:确保选择正确的文件格式进行导出,例如.xlsx
或.csv
。
10、安装缺失字体:安装Excel文件中使用的特定字体。
11、显示隐藏内容:通过查看“格式”菜单中的“隐藏和取消隐藏”来恢复隐藏的单元格或行。
12、检查宏设置:检查宏设置,并确保允许宏运行。
13、检查硬件:尝试在不同的电脑上打开文件,以排除硬件问题。
FAQs
1、问:为什么Excel导出时提示“文件格式不对”?
答:这可能是由于文件损坏、格式不兼容、文件扩展名错误等原因导致的,可以尝试使用Excel的“打开并修复”功能修复文件,或者更新Excel版本以支持更多文件格式。
2、问:Excel导出的文件无法打开是怎么回事?
答:这可能是由于文件损坏、权限问题、Excel应用程序问题等原因导致的,可以检查文件是否损坏,确保有足够的权限导出文件,或者尝试重新启动Excel应用程序。